Abstract

Provided herein are compositions for the treatment and/or prevention of cardiovascular disease (CVD), and methods of application and use thereof. In particular, the present invention provides treatment and/or prevention of cardiovascular disease with compounds that inhibit the production of TMA in the gut, such as 3,3-dimethyl-1-butanol (DMB) or other compounds represented by Formula I or as shown in FIGS. 20 - 23.
